小程序已成為人們生活和工作中不可或缺的一部分。無論是購物、娛樂還是辦公,小程序都為我們提供了便捷的服務。然而,隨著小程序的廣泛應用,其安全性問題也日益凸顯。那么,如何才能保持小程序的安全性呢?
一、代碼安全
代碼混淆:對小程序的代碼進行混淆處理,將代碼中的變量名、函數名等替換為無意義的字符,增加代碼的閱讀難度,防止代碼被反編譯和惡意篡改。
代碼加密:采用加密算法對小程序的核心代碼進行加密,只有在運行時才進行解密,確保代碼在傳輸和存儲過程中的安全性。
二、數據安全
數據加密:對小程序中傳輸和存儲的敏感數據,如用戶賬號、密碼、身份證號等,進行加密處理,防止數據被竊取和篡改。
數據校驗:在小程序接收和處理數據時,進行嚴格的數據校驗,確保數據的完整性和合法性,防止數據被注入攻擊。
數據備份:定期對小程序中的數據進行備份,以防數據丟失或損壞。同時,要確保備份數據的安全性,防止備份數據被泄露。
三、接口安全
接口鑒權:對小程序調用的接口進行鑒權,確保只有合法的用戶和應用才能訪問接口,防止接口被惡意調用。
接口加密:對接口傳輸的數據進行加密,防止數據在傳輸過程中被竊取和篡改。
接口限流:對接口的調用頻率進行限制,防止接口被惡意攻擊,導致系統癱瘓。
四、安全監測與應急響應
安全監測:建立安全監測機制,實時監測小程序的運行狀態和安全狀況,及時發現和處理安全隱患。
應急響應:制定應急預案,當小程序發生安全事件時,能夠迅速啟動應急預案,采取有效的措施進行處理,降低安全事件造成的損失。
保持小程序的安全性需要從代碼安全、數據安全、接口安全以及安全監測與應急響應等多個方面入手。只有這樣,才能確保小程序的安全穩定運行,為用戶提供更加可靠的服務。作為小程序開發者和運營者,我們要時刻關注小程序的安全問題,不斷加強安全防護措施,為用戶的信息安全保駕護航。